Further info:
The accompanying Jaguar Heritage Certificate records this RHD MOD 3.8 saloon was despatched on 29 June 1964 and registered in Bradford, Yorks. Resident in South Africa for some twenty years, it was restored there between 2006 and 2011 before being imported into the UK and purchased by a Jaguar specialist as his personal transport. A report on file records his belief the restoration was to a high standard and whilst no invoices are available he estimates the cost at 2013 prices to have been in excess of £30,000 - a detailed breakdown of his finding is present in the history file. A 5 speed Toyota Supra gearbox was also installed in place of the Moss box - a recognised and beneficial conversion. Due to work pressures he decided to sell it to the vendor in 2013 who has carried out a number of improvement works including the fitting of a Kenlowe fan, new clutch, Coombs-style spats, chrome wire wheels and fitted luggage. This Mk2 is definitely worthy of close inspection.
